Over-Approximating Minimizer Sets of Constrained Convex Programs with Parametric Uncertainty via Reachability Analysis
A reachability-analysis method on projected gradient descent dynamics produces certified outer approximations to the minimizer sets of strongly convex programs whose costs depend on bounded uncertain parameters.

Robustly Constrained Dynamic Games for Uncertain Nonlinear Dynamics
A robustly constrained Nash equilibrium is defined and computed via iterative best response for dynamic games with state-dependent noise and nonlinear constraints using system-level synthesis.
